The role
As a St John Ambulance Community Advocate,
your task will be to raise awareness of the importance of first
aid, within your local area.
You’ll be handing out information to the
public and delivering first aid workshops at community centres,
local events and groups.
You’ll also support and mentor local Community
Champions, helping them get the most out of their involvement with
St John Ambulance.
Training and time commitment
We’ll give you all the training and support
you need to help inspire others into acquiring first aid skills. No
previous experience in first aid is required.
As this is a flexible volunteering role, you
can give as much time as suits your lifestyle.
